Building Trust with High-Quality Content

To establish credibility as an affiliate site owner or agency scaling publishing on a new domain, it’s essential to incorporate high-quality content into your link building strategy. This approach focuses on creating valuable resources that showcase your expertise and resonate with your target audience.

Research Relevant Keywords and Topics

Conduct thorough keyword research using tools like Google Keyword Planner or Ahrefs to identify relevant topics and phrases with moderate to high search volumes. Identify gaps in the market and opportunities to create unique, informative content that addresses user needs.

  • Actionable step: Use a keyword clustering tool to group related terms and prioritize your content creation based on search volume and competition.

Create In-Depth Content Guides

Develop comprehensive content guides that provide valuable insights, tips, and strategies on topics relevant to your niche. These guides can include tutorials, case studies, and expert interviews.

By creating high-quality content, you establish yourself as a thought leader in the industry and build trust with your audience.

  • Checklist:

• Develop a unique angle or perspective for your guide

• Include actionable tips and takeaways

• Use visuals, such as infographics or videos, to enhance engagement

Produce High-Quality Blog Posts and Articles

Regularly publish well-researched blog posts and articles that cater to specific audience segments or niches. Optimize titles, meta descriptions, and headings for better visibility using SEO best practices. Ensure that your content is engaging, informative, and free of duplicate or low-quality content.

  • Concrete example: Create a comprehensive guide on “The Ultimate Guide to [Niche Topic]” with over 10,000 words and include a downloadable resource, such as an e-book or webinar recording.

Leverage User-Generated Content (UGC) and Reviews

Encourage users to share their experiences and reviews on your site by implementing a user-friendly feedback system. This approach not only builds trust but also provides valuable social proof for potential customers.

Identifying Relevant Links through Research and Tools

Identifying relevant links is a crucial step in white hat link building for affiliate sites. This process involves researching potential partners, analyzing their content, and identifying opportunities to collaborate.

To start, agencies should focus on creating a comprehensive list of target domains, including but not limited to:

  • Industry leaders
  • Influencer websites
  • Relevant news sources
  • High-quality blogs

Agencies can utilize various research tools to streamline this process, such as:

  • Ahrefs: A popular SEO tool that provides insights into backlinks, content gaps, and keyword opportunities.
  • SEMrush: A comprehensive marketing tool that offers features like competitor analysis, keyword research, and link building suggestions.
  • Moz: A well-established SEO platform that provides access to a vast database of high-quality backlinks.

By leveraging these tools, agencies can efficiently identify potential partners and prioritize their outreach efforts.

For example, if an agency is targeting the fitness industry, they may use Ahrefs to analyze the backlinks of popular fitness websites and identify opportunities to collaborate with relevant influencers.

Additionally, agencies should also focus on creating high-quality content that showcases their expertise in a particular niche. This can help attract linkable assets from other sites, such as infographics, eBooks, or webinars.

By focusing on content creation and outreach, agencies can build a strong foundation for white hat link building and drive successful affiliate marketing campaigns.

Establishing a Safe and Effective Link Building Workflow on New Domains

As an affiliate site owner or agency, it’s vital to implement a structured approach to white hat link building on new domains. This weekly workflow ensures safe publishing practices while scaling your efforts.

Weekly Workflow Components

1. Domain Maturity and Content Prioritization (Weeks 1-4)

  • Ensure your new domain has matured for at least 3-6 months before initiating extensive link building.
  • Focus on creating high-quality, informative content that provides value to users.
  • Use long-tail keywords strategically, but avoid keyword stuffing.

Example: Create a comprehensive guide to “The Ultimate Guide to [Niche]” including affiliate links to relevant products and tools in the industry.

2. Guest Blogging (Wholesome Outreach) and Resource Pages (Weeks 5-8)

  • Identify reputable websites in your niche and offer valuable content or expertise as a guest blogger.
  • Provide linkable assets, such as infographics or eBooks, that align with the host site’s audience interests.

Checklist:

  • Research potential guest blogging opportunities
  • Craft high-quality, relevant content for each opportunity
  • Include affiliate links to products mentioned in context

3. Niche-Specific Directories and Linkable Assets (Weeks 9-12)

  • Develop comprehensive resource pages covering topics within your niche.
  • Create valuable resources such as infographics, videos, or checklists that provide immense value to users.

Example: Host a ‘Top 10 Tools for [Niche]’ infographic on your domain, linking to relevant products and tools in the industry.
